Lovato DMG2000 is the modular network analyser on DIN rail with colour display and integrated Ethernet: it measures energy and electrical parameters with class 0.5s accuracy and harmonic analysis up to the 63rd order, ideal for plant monitoring.
Type: multifunction digital measuring instrument / network analyser
Installation: 35 mm DIN rail
Display: colour
Auxiliary power supply: 100/240 VAC
Current reading: via CT /5A /1A
Active energy accuracy: Class 0.5s (IEC/EN 62053-22)
Reactive energy: Class 2 (IEC/EN 62053-23)
Harmonic analysis: up to the 63rd order
Integrated communication: Yes
Ethernet port: integrated
Expandable: No
The Lovato DMG2000 network analyser multimeter is a multifunction digital instrument designed for measuring and supervising the main electrical parameters in industrial, tertiary, and building automation installations. Thanks to its modular format on a 35 mm DIN rail, it easily integrates into electrical panels, simplifying the adoption of an energy monitoring system without overhauling the existing wiring. The colour display enhances the user experience: it allows for clear visualization of voltages, currents, powers, and energies, facilitating quick checks during testing, maintenance, and diagnostics.
When the goal is to account for or analyse consumption, accuracy matters. DMG2000 offers an active energy measurement accuracy of Class 0.5s according to IEC/EN 62053-22, a specification suitable for many monitoring and internal consumption allocation applications. For reactive energy, the classification is Class 2 according to IEC/EN 62053-23, useful for evaluating power factor correction and inefficiencies related to inductive loads, optimizing costs and performance of the installation.
With the increase of inverters, UPS, switching power supplies, and LED lighting, the presence of harmonics is increasingly common. The DMG2000 integrates harmonic analysis up to the 63rd order, a fundamental tool for identifying distortions and criticalities that can cause overheating, untimely tripping, or reduced component lifespan. Having this data directly at the panel, with a colour display, helps to intervene more precisely on filters, power factor correction, and load balancing.
The presence of the integrated Ethernet port makes the DMG2000 particularly convenient in contexts where centralized data collection is required. By connecting it to the LAN network, you can integrate the instrument into supervision, energy monitoring, or predictive maintenance systems, improving visibility on consumption and electrical parameters. Being non-expandable, the DMG2000 is a compact and complete solution designed for those who want a ready-to-use device without additional modules.
The DMG2000 measures current through current transformers (CT) with secondary /5A or /1A, a compatibility that facilitates installation in new installations and replacement/upgrades in existing panels. The auxiliary power supply 100240 VAC further simplifies integration, adapting to the main panel power supplies.
| Auxiliary power supply (Us) | |
|---|---|
| Nominal auxiliary AC voltage | 100…240 VAC |
| Nominal auxiliary DC voltage | 110…250 VDC |
| AC operating limits | 85…264 VAC |
| DC operating limits | 93.5…300 VDC |
| Operating frequency | 45…66 Hz |
| Max absorbed power | 3.2 VA |
| Maximum dissipated power | 1.3 W |
| Voltage measurement inputs | |
| Nominal phase-to-phase voltage (Ue) | 600 VAC |
| Nominal phase-to-neutral voltage (Ue) | 400 VAC |
| Phase-to-phase measurement range | 20…830 VAC |
| Phase-to-neutral measurement range | 10…480 VAC |
| Operating frequency | 45…66 Hz |
| Measurement method | True RMS |
| Insertion mode | Single-phase, two-phase, three-phase lines with or without neutral, balanced three-phase |
| Current inputs | |
| Nominal current (Ie) | 1 / 5 A |
| Measurement range | 0.01…1.2 A / 0.01…6 A |
| Measurement method | TRMS |
| Overload capacity | +20% Ie from external CT with 5A secondary |
| Accuracy | |
| Phase voltage | ±0.2% |
| Line voltage | ±0.2% |
| Current | ±0.2% |
| Frequency | ±0.05% |
| Active power | ±0.5% |
| Active energy | Class 0.5s (IEC/EN 62053-22) |
| Reactive energy | Classe 2 (IEC/EN 62053-23) |
| Insulations | |
| Rated insulation voltage | 690 V (IEC/EN) |
| Rated impulse withstand voltage (Uimp) | 9.5 kV |
| Withstand voltage at operating frequency | 5.2 kV |
| Functions | |
| Harmonic analysis | Up to the 63rd order |
| Programmable PLC logic | No |
| Communication port | Ethernet |
| Ethernet-RS485 gateway function | Yes |
